AT&T Just Won’t Cancel My Service
Called over four days in one week and spoke to 8 reps. Even got a cancellation number. Today I got a bill for a landline I’ve tried to cancel since last Saturday 4/2. Phone line still active (rings) and from online account still getting billed through May 1st.
I want to cancel my landline and ensure that my internet will not be affected. Please this has been so frustrating and stressful.
What can I do to cancel my landline?

Your final month of service is not prorated. Once you start a billing month, you are billed for the entire month. If your bill is through 5/1, that means your new month started 4/2. You needed to cancel before 4/2 to avoid another bill. It sounds to me like your service is cancelled and that’s your final bill.
